Preparing the Chicken
Start by choosing a fresh 5-pound whole chicken. Remove any giblets and pat the chicken dry with paper towels. Season generously with your favorite herbs and spices—think garlic, rosemary, salt, and pepper for a classic flavor.
For even cooking, truss the legs and tuck the wing tips under the body. This helps achieve a uniform roast and crispy skin.

Cooking the Whole Chicken
Insert the seasoned chicken into the top rack or the bottom, depending on your preferred heat flow. Use the Smart Finish feature to cook the chicken and any side dishes simultaneously, ensuring both are ready at the same time.
Cook for about 1 hour and 15 minutes, or until the internal temperature reaches 165°F. Use a meat thermometer for accuracy. The superheated air surrounds the chicken, giving it a crispy, golden skin while keeping the meat juicy.
Serving and Tips
Once cooked, let the chicken rest for 10 minutes before carving. This ensures the juices redistribute, keeping the meat moist.
Pair your roasted chicken with summer vegetables or a fresh salad for a complete meal. The Ninja Air Fryer’s easy-to-clean, dishwasher-safe parts make post-meal cleanup quick and effortless.
